Skeletal remains found near Detroit Lake handed over to examiner's office

Posted: Updated:
NEAR DETROIT LAKE, OR (KPTV) -

Bones found by hunters in a remote area off Highway 22 on Saturday are being sent to the Oregon Medical Examiner's Office for examination.

The skeletal remains were discovered in the Santiam Canyon near Niagara Falls Park and Detroit Lake.

Marion County investigators said they believe the remains are those of a human, but they haven't determined the identity of the person.

The last search in the area for remains were connected to the murder of a Bend woman. Investigators do not yet know if the remains are linked to that case.

Steven Blaylock, of Bend, was found guilty last fall of killing his wife Lori and dumping her body in a river.

At first, Blaylock told investigators that his wife walked away from their home and never came back. He later admitted to the murder, but Lori Blaylock's body was never found.
